Definition of birder no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

birder

noun
 
/ˈbɜːdə(r)/
 
/ˈbɜːrdər/
(informal)
jump to other results
  1. a birdwatcher (= a person who watches birds in their natural environment and identifies different species as a hobby)
    • The data was collected by thousands of birders.
    • The island is a popular spot for birders.
